Coins, premium story access, and subscription status are not stored on your phone. They are stored on Wattpad’s cloud servers. When you open a premium chapter, your app asks Wattpad’s server: "Does this user have coins?" Wattpad Beta Apk Mod Unlock All

| Red Flag | What to Look For | | :--- | :--- | | | Official Wattpad is ~40MB. A mod claiming "unlimited everything" that is 5MB or 200MB is almost certainly malware. | | Permissions | The mod asks for "Make Phone Calls" or "Read SMS." Wattpad never needs this. | | Outdated Version | The mod claims to be "Beta v10.8.5" but Wattpad's current version is 10.9.0. Outdated mods break within days. | | No OBB File | Large mods requiring an OBB (data file) are often game hacks, not Wattpad. A single APK for Wattpad is usually a fake. | The Verdict: Should You Download It? No. Absolutely not.
